[arch-commits] Commit in msgpack-c/trunk (PKGBUILD test-cflags.patch)
Baptiste Jonglez
zorun at archlinux.org
Sat May 12 00:52:40 UTC 2018
Date: Saturday, May 12, 2018 @ 00:52:39
Author: zorun
Revision: 320917
upgpkg: msgpack-c 3.0.0-1
Modified:
msgpack-c/trunk/PKGBUILD
Deleted:
msgpack-c/trunk/test-cflags.patch
-------------------+
PKGBUILD | 17 +++++------------
test-cflags.patch | 11 -----------
2 files changed, 5 insertions(+), 23 deletions(-)
Modified: PKGBUILD
===================================================================
--- PKGBUILD 2018-05-12 00:52:09 UTC (rev 320916)
+++ PKGBUILD 2018-05-12 00:52:39 UTC (rev 320917)
@@ -3,8 +3,8 @@
# Contributor: Auguste Pop <auguste [at] gmail [dot] com>
pkgname=msgpack-c
-pkgver=2.1.5
-pkgrel=2
+pkgver=3.0.0
+pkgrel=1
pkgdesc='An efficient object serialization library'
arch=("x86_64")
url='http://msgpack.org/'
@@ -12,20 +12,13 @@
depends=("glibc")
checkdepends=("gtest")
makedepends=("cmake")
-source=("https://github.com/msgpack/msgpack-c/releases/download/cpp-${pkgver}/msgpack-${pkgver}.tar.gz"
- "test-cflags.patch")
-sha256sums=('6126375af9b204611b9d9f154929f4f747e4599e6ae8443b337915dcf2899d2b'
- '0e6bd401c3ff6f6c68e8beca682b1ecb1b125092a1b1739757294c3c040ba481')
+source=("https://github.com/msgpack/msgpack-c/releases/download/cpp-${pkgver}/msgpack-${pkgver}.tar.gz")
+sha256sums=('bfbb71b7c02f806393bc3cbc491b40523b89e64f83860c58e3e54af47de176e4')
-prepare() {
- cd "msgpack-${pkgver}"
- # Remove -Werror when building tests (useless and makes build fail)
- patch -p0 < "$srcdir"/test-cflags.patch
-}
-
build() {
cd "msgpack-${pkgver}"
cmake -DCMAKE_INSTALL_PREFIX=/usr \
+ -DCMAKE_BUILD_TYPE=None \
-DMSGPACK_CXX11=ON \
-DMSGPACK_BUILD_EXAMPLES=OFF \
.
Deleted: test-cflags.patch
===================================================================
--- test-cflags.patch 2018-05-12 00:52:09 UTC (rev 320916)
+++ test-cflags.patch 2018-05-12 00:52:39 UTC (rev 320917)
@@ -1,11 +0,0 @@
---- test/CMakeLists.txt.old 2017-06-11 17:11:18.413443078 +0200
-+++ test/CMakeLists.txt 2017-06-11 17:11:39.383317557 +0200
-@@ -80,7 +80,7 @@
- )
- ADD_TEST (${source_file_we} ${source_file_we})
- IF ("${CMAKE_CXX_COMPILER_ID}" STREQUAL "Clang" OR "${CMAKE_CXX_COMPILER_ID}" STREQUAL "GNU")
-- SET_PROPERTY (TARGET ${source_file_we} APPEND_STRING PROPERTY COMPILE_FLAGS "-Wall -Wextra -Werror -g -O3 ")
-+ SET_PROPERTY (TARGET ${source_file_we} APPEND_STRING PROPERTY COMPILE_FLAGS "-Wall -Wextra -g -O3 ")
- ENDIF ()
- IF ("${CMAKE_CXX_COMPILER_ID}" STREQUAL "Clang")
- SET_PROPERTY (TARGET ${source_file_we} APPEND_STRING PROPERTY COMPILE_FLAGS " -Wno-mismatched-tags")
More information about the arch-commits
mailing list